基础信息
- ADC中的AD_OTR引脚:
代表out of range,模拟输入超出了AD的转换范围 - 8位位宽-digital data
- 输入/输出模拟电压范围为-5V~+5V,旋钮可调
- 供电电压(+2.7V~+5.5V),建议电压3.3V
- AD芯片:3PA9280
DA芯片:3PD9708
转换速率:125MSPS(DA),32MSPS(AD) MSPS-Mega Samples Per Second

- 硬件描述
上面那个比较厚的是AD,9280,引脚带OTR,剩下就是5V、GND、D0-D7、CLK
下面是DA9708,D0-D7、CLK - rasberry pi pins

搭建思路
- 分配管脚,xdc文件get,对应连接Dx到GPIO
- 面包板连线
- 测试代码
- sin signal Analog in
- AD输入FPGA
- DA输出到模块(wire直连)
- 模拟输出,示波器对比观察
vivado board file配置
下载导入PYNQ-Z2板子的vivado配置文件(board file),创建工程
下载地址

下载后解压放到Vivado的安装路径下的data\boards\board_files


之后在创建工程选择板卡时选择即可

测试烧录
一个简单的led闪烁代码
- 时钟

PHYRSTB拉低时, Ethernet PHY (U5) 引脚为重置状态,使125MHz时钟失效。更详细信息在:xilinx官网的 “7 Series FPGAs Clocking Resources User Guide”
xdc文件中的信息也说明,PL端的时钟默认为125MHz,H16引脚
## Clock signal

最低0.47元/天 解锁文章
9107

被折叠的 条评论
为什么被折叠?



